Abstract

A laboratory experiment was conducted to study the persistence of pretilachlor (new formulation Rifit) in water at acidic, neutral and alkaline pH by incubating for 60 days in beakers. The degradation pattern of pretilachlor in the water samples indicated that, irrespective of pH, pretilachlor residues were detected upto 15 days after application and were below detectable limit on 30th day. The half -life of pretitachlor in different pH water varied from 3.05 to 3.30 days and there was not much difference in half- life due to increase or decrease in pH of irrigation water.
